First tnk to all for this USB Loader

I use Ultimate rev 7.4 USB loader and work very good with around 100 games , but with some ISO I got green screen.
I have Wii 3.2u with cIOScorp rev2 fix, usb2beta3, cISO36 rev 10 and I have HDTV component cable (I try with AV regular cable, same).

Well some Iso like:

Rogue Tropper PAL
Ben 10 PAL
Mario Party 8 PAL
and around 10 mores....

What I need to set ?

I try:
Force NTSC and VidTV on - Green sreen
Force PAL50 and VidTv off - Fleak image
Force PAL60 and VidTv off - Fleak image
Force PAL60 and VidTV on - Audio Work but no image ( but game work)
Force System video - Green screen

Well I try a lot off combination but no luck

This is not true. I play plenty of PAL games including Rogue Trooper, Pikmin 1 & 2 on my NTSC console. The reason the games aren't working for you is because you dont have the right settings or tools to play the games. I have a WiiKey and none of these games work for me so i have to resort to using Gecko OS 1.9 or any USB Loader that allows auto patching or video patching. Forcing NTSC works for most PAL games but not for a few like Rogue Trooper.
